There are a total of 2 public schools, n/a private schools and n/a post-secondary schools in Abita Springs. Using the proficiency score averages, the average test scores for Abita Springs, LA schools is 83%. The average student to teacher ratio is 16:1. In Abita Springs, LA, an average of 91.0% of students have completed 8th grade and an average of 90.3% have completed high school.
